Police report five individuals, including two children, found deceased in US residence | US News
Police in the US state of Oklahoma have discovered five deceased individuals, including two children, at a residence. Sergeant Gary Knight has stated that all five victims appear to have been the victims of murder.
He emphasized that this was not a case of carbon monoxide poisoning, but rather a deliberate act of violence resulting in the deaths of these individuals.
The individuals found dead included a man and a woman, as well as two students currently attending Mustang Public Schools – one in sixth grade and the other in ninth grade. The fifth victim was a recent graduate of the school system.
Charles Bradley, superintendent of Mustang Public Schools, expressed shock and heartbreak over the tragedy, stating that it is incomprehensible.
Reports indicate that a 10-year-old discovered the bodies, and police are treating the incident as a shooting after finding a gun on top of one of the deceased individuals.
